Bermuda - Alloy Steel Metal Scrap Imports
Since 2011, Bermuda Alloy Steel Metal Scrap Imports decreased by 32.3% year on year. With $4,154 Thousand in 2016, the country was number 112 comparing other countries in Alloy Steel Metal Scrap Imports. Bermuda is overtaken by Venezuela, which was number 111 at $4,655 Thousand and is followed by Ivory Coast with $4,048 Thousand. China topped the ranking with $282,795,561.35 Thousand in 2019, that is a growth of 2.1% versus 2018. United States, Pakistan and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sri Lanka recorded the best 5 years average growth at +168.4% per year, while Guatemala witnessed the worst performance at -78.7% per year.
